Shared Guilt Complex

Wiki Article

The notion of a national guilt complex is a fascinating one, often analyzed in the context of history and cultural trends. It suggests that a nation as a whole may carry a weight of guilt for past actions, even if those actions were committed by a subset within its population. This potential can manifest in various ways, such as a fixation with atonement, or a feeling of collective shame that shapes national identity and actions.
